Tofan Constantin

Tofan Constantin is an artist. 2 works are cataloged here, principally at Gavrila Simion Eco-Museum Research Institute Tulcea.

Tofan Constantin painted quiet scenes of Romanian life. His brush kept close to home: the 1930s Bucharest riverfront in “Insula” and the rolling Carpathian foothills in the woodcut “Peisaj.” There’s no grand theory to his work—just a painter’s eye for the plain geometry of courtyards, windows, and distant church spires.
